DHX Studios – Vancouver is looking for a creative and experienced Development Hair/Cloth TD to join our team and assist in the development of our Hair/Cloth Simulations department. Your creative and technical skills will be pushed to the boundaries as you flex your talents on high quality productions. This role is a key addition to our Development team, which is responsible for the development of new animated projects and pipeline R&D. The successful candidate will be highly motivated to push the boundaries of what is creatively possible and be passionate about R&D.
- Creation of innovative and believable hair and cloth simulations which meet required design aesthetic
- Groom and shade hair and fur assets
- Provide ongoing support and integration of hair and cloth assets in to the pipeline
- Create hair and cloth simulations for shot work in production
- Mentor FX artists in production in regards to workflow and production best practices
- Develop tools and workflow used to create hair and cloth assets
- Meet production deadlines and maintain regular communication with the production team
- Communicate with Modelling Lead, Animation Lead, and CG Supervisor about production issues
- Work collaboratively with design, modelling, rigging and animation teams
- Assist in the development of the Simulations Pipeline under the guidance of the Pipeline Supervisor
- Additional responsibilities as required
- 3+ years of related production experience in Maya as a Character TD or Simulations Artist
- Thorough understanding of simulation techniques and technologies
- Advanced knowledge in Maya is essential
- Strong knowledge in nCloth, nHair, xGen, Yeti, and/or other simulation systems
- Excellent understanding of basic human kinetics and basic real world physics
- Excellent understanding of rigging and deformation techniques
- Knowledge of V-Ray is a plus
